How to Obtain Health Coverage for Pregnancy

Pregnancy can bring about a lot of excitement and joy, but it also comes with its own set of challenges, including the cost of healthcare. Expectant mothers need to have adequate health coverage to ensure that they receive the necessary medical care during pregnancy and delivery. In this article, we will discuss how to obtainhealth coverage for pregnancy.

1. Check Your Current Health Insurance Policy

The first step is to check your current health insurance policy to see if it covers pregnancy-related expenses. Some policies may not cover all the expenses associated with pregnancy, such as prenatal care, delivery, and postpartum care. If your policy does not cover these expenses, you may need to look for additional coverage.

2. Consider Employer-Sponsored Health Plans

Many employers offer health insurance plans that cover pregnancy-related expenses. These plans may be more affordable than purchasingindividual health insurance. Check with your employer to see what options are available to you.

3. Look for Individual Health Insurance Plans

If you are self-employed or your employer does not offer health insurance, you may need to purchase an individual health insurance plan. Look for plans that cover pregnancy-related expenses, such as prenatal care, delivery, and postpartum care. Be sure to compare different plans to find the one that best fits your needs and budget.

4. Consider Medicaid

Medicaid is a government-funded program that provides health coverage to low-income individuals and families. If you meet the income requirements, you may be eligible for Medicaid coverage during your pregnancy and for a certain period after delivery. Contact your local Medicaid office to see if you qualify.

5. Look into Maternity Health Insurance

Some insurance companies offer maternity health insurance policies specifically designed to cover pregnancy-related expenses. These policies typically cover prenatal care, delivery, and postpartum care. However, these policies may be more expensive than traditional health insurance plans.

6. Review Your Options Carefully

When looking for health coverage for pregnancy, it is important to review your options carefully. Consider the cost of the policy, the deductibles, and the co-payments. Also, make sure the policy covers all the expenses associated with pregnancy, including prenatal care, delivery, and postpartum care.
